Full‐length coding sequence analysis of the voltage‐gated sodium channel and acetylcholinesterase genes reveals target‐site mutations and acetylcholinesterase gene duplication in housefly (Musca domestica) populations in Japanese livestock barns

open access: yesMedical and Veterinary Entomology, EarlyView.
We simultaneously analysed insecticide resistance mutations in VGSC and AChE using NGS and hybridization probe capture in houseflies collected from livestock facilities for the first time. Resistance mutations in both VGSC and AChE were detected in most wild populations, suggesting widespread distribution of resistance genes.

Molecular bases of insect odorant receptor function: specificity and evolution

open access: yesBiological Reviews, Volume 101, Issue 2, Page 1036-1049, April 2026.
ABSTRACT Insect odorant receptors (ORs) are a class of chemoreceptors that insects use to detect volatile cues in their environment. In recent years, major advances in the field of structural biology have made it possible to obtain the first structures of insect ORs.
